  • Radeon HD 4850 X2 has 1566% more power consumption, than HD Graphics 5300.
  • HD Graphics 5300 is connected by PCIe 2.0 x1, and Radeon HD 4850 X2 uses PCIe 2.0 x16 interface.
  • HD Graphics 5300 is used in Laptops, and Radeon HD 4850 X2 - in Desktops.
  • HD Graphics 5300 is build with Gen. 8 Broadwell architecture, and Radeon HD 4850 X2 - with TeraScale.
  • Core clock speed of Radeon HD 4850 X2 is 525 MHz higher, than HD Graphics 5300.
  • HD Graphics 5300 is manufactured by 14 nm process technology, and Radeon HD 4850 X2 - by 55 nm process technology.
